Ivan Triesault
Ivan Triesault left a distinctive mark as a character actor who brought a quiet intensity to his roles. Fans familiar with 1950s adventure cinema might recognize him as Arne Saknussemm in the 1959 sci-fi classic Journey to the Center of the Earth, a film that captured imaginations with its blend of exploration and suspense. Triesault's performance lent an air of gravitas to the mysterious figure whose ancient discoveries set the story in motion, making the fantastical expedition feel grounded. Beyond this, he frequently portrayed European aristocrats, scientists, and officials, often embodying the subtle menace or refined authority needed to elevate a supporting character into a memorable presence. His work in films like Alfred Hitchcock’s Saboteur showcased his ability to slip seamlessly into thrillers, while his collaboration with studios like Universal helped define the look and tone of mid-century genre films. Triesault’s steady screen presence enriched many productions, providing a connective thread through varied narratives with a blend of quiet command and enigmatic charm.
